Composed by Jules Massent. Arranged by Peyber A. Medina H. This edition: pdf. Concert, Romantic Period, Wedding. Score and parts. 10 pages. Peyber Medina #2835645. Published by Peyber Medina (A0.866873).Adaptation for string quartet from the beautiful symphonic intermezzo of the opera Thaïs by French composer Jules Massenet. A really prodigious piece well thought-out for been performed in concerts as well like special occasions.

Not ready for Prime Time!
Performed this arrangement for the funeral of the Concertmaster Emeritus of a leading American orchestra. Received the score and parts on two days notice. Spent 4+ hours correcting outright note errors, awkward voicing, and worst of all, completely wrong harmonies due to inattentive copy/paste of material that Massenet reharmonized in the recap. Largely rewrote the awkward viola part to increase playability to capture the essence of the original harp part more faithfully. Had we sightread these parts as printed, it would have been an embarrassing disaster!Its disconcerting to think that an arranger wouldnt have someone play through the parts before listing the music for sale at a price Id expect from an established publisher.
